Immersed

Immersed is a new body of work that has been stirring in my mind for the last few years since moving back home to Hawaii. When I worked on The Lei Maker for the Honolulu International Airport, I created several panels with water and the human figure. It was challenging for me to paint water and the figure but the struggles intrigued me. After I completed the project, I studied with Alyssa Monks in New York who is an inspiring artist that paints in an abstract and  realistic style. That experience influences my color palette and my approach to painting. 

This was my first water study in oil on canvas for Immersed.
